Young girl killed and three seriously injured in Carndonagh collision 

A YOUNG girl has died and three others have been seriously injured following a fatal road collision in Carndonagh.

Gardaí and emergency services attended the scene of the collision, which involved a car and a van, on the R240 at Carrowmore, Glentogher shortly before 6.30pm yesterday.

A female passenger, a young girl, was pronounced dead at the scene.

A garda spokesperson said: “A female driver (age unknown) of the car, a male front seat passenger (age unknown) and a female child who was a rear passenger were all removed from the scene to Altnagelvin Hospital, Derry where they all remain in a serious condition.

“No other injuries have been reported at this time.”

Meanwhile, the road is currently closed for a technical examination by Forensic Collision Investigators and local diversions in place.

Gardaí are appealing to anyone who may have witnessed this collision to contact them.

“Any road users who may have camera footage (including dash-cam) and were travelling in the area between 6pm and 6.30pm this evening Wednesday July 2, 2025 are asked to make this footage available to investigating gardaí,” a garda spokesperson continued.

“Anyone with information is asked to contact Buncrana Garda Station at 074 932 0540, the Garda Confidential Line on 1800 666 111, or any Garda Station.”
